Effective Saturday, the fire danger level and public use restriction level will increase to EXTREME for all private, county, state and Bureau of Indian Affairs land within the Douglas District
The Roseburg District BLM is included in the fire season declaration, which imposes certain fire restrictions on the public and industrial operators to help prevent wildfires and has specific Fire Prevention Orders or other public use restrictions on the BLM-administered lands.
Public Information Officer Rachel Pope of the Douglas Forest Protective Association said the Industrial Fire Precaution Level within the Douglas District will remain at IFPL 3. This includes inside regulated use areas and all forestland within one-eighth mile thereof.
For the public, non-industrial power saw usage, cutting, grinding, or welding of metal, cutting, trimming, or mowing of dried, cured grass, and power-driven machinery for non-industrial improvement or development on private property is now prohibited.
